Collections

Julie Mehretu
Epigraph, Damascus2016

Not on view
Six-panel charcoal or graphite drawing with dense, gestural black marks forming a continuous tangled mass across white paper, thinning toward the lower edges of each panel
Large-scale drawing on white paper combining faint pencil architectural sketches of building facades with energetic black ink marks, gestural brushstrokes, and scattered calligraphic traces layered densely across the surface.
Large-scale drawing on paper with dense layering of black charcoal or ink marks on a gray ground; energetic gestural strokes, branching linear forms, crosshatched areas, and fluid drips create an all-over abstract composition.
Artist or Maker
Julie Mehretu
Ethiopia, Addis Ababa (Shewa), active United States, New York, New York, born 1970
Title
Epigraph, Damascus
Date Made
2016
Medium
Photogravure, sugar lift aquatint, spit bite aquatint, and open bite on six panels
Dimensions
Sheet (each): 85 7/16 × 34 1/4 in. (217.01 × 87 cm) Framed (overall): 97 1/2 × 226 in. (247.65 × 574.04 cm)
Credit Line
Gift of Kelvin Davis and Hana Kim through the 2018 Collectors Committee
Accession Number
M.2018.188a-f
Classification
Prints
Collecting Area
Contemporary Art
